Prohibited Signs in Skiatook

  • Off premises signs that carry a commercial message are prohibited.
  • Signs that are not securely affixed to the ground, or not permanently affixed to an approved supporting structure are prohibited.
  • Portable signs are prohibited, except for one existing sign per property as of the passage of the section and subject to certain conditions.
  • Bracket or projecting signs are prohibited (except in Downtown Area).
  • Roof signs are prohibited.
  • Billboards are prohibited.
  • No sign or other device shall obstruct the free and clear vision of vehicle drivers, or be displayed where its position, shape, or color may confuse or interfere with authorized traffic or government signs.
  • No sign or advertising device shall be erected on, placed on, projected, or overhang any right-of-way, walkway, street, alley, or easement (exception in Downtown Area).
  • It is unlawful to use a vehicle or trailer as a sign in circumvention of the ordinance.
  • No signs shall be placed on any private property without the consent of the owner.
  • No signs shall be placed or painted on any tree or rock.
  • No signs shall be placed on utility poles except for utility identification or similar purposes.
  • Balloons, floating devices and inflatables are prohibited.
  • No portable, mobile, vehicular or snipe sign is permitted within the City; no motorized vehicle or trailer shall be parked for the purpose of advertising (with exception for commercial vehicle identification info).
  • Signs placed on public sidewalks are prohibited (except in Downtown Area).
  • Signs, placards, notices, advertisements, or displays of any nature are prohibited on utility poles, traffic control devices, sign structures, or structures supporting the same, which are located on any street, or public or municipal easement or right-of-way.
  • No sign may be placed in a position to obscure the view of motorists.
  • No sign may be placed within a sight triangle at street intersections.
  • No sign may be placed or maintained in violation of the ordinance; temporary signs in violation may be removed by the inspector without notice.
  • Signs in right-of-way, public property, or public easement are prohibited except as specifically permitted.
  • No sign may be placed within fifteen feet of a fire hydrant.
  • Signs may not be placed or affixed to utility apparatus.

Exempt Signs in Skiatook

  • Official public notices and notices by public officers in performance of their duties.
  • Governmental signs for control or direction of traffic and other regulatory purposes.
  • Flags or emblems of the United States, State of Oklahoma, or their political subdivisions, provided flag is no more than 60 square feet in area and flown from a pole no higher than 40 feet; up to 2 feather flags allowed for patriotic or holiday decoration.
  • Memorial plaques, cornerstones, historical tablets, and similar items.
  • Signs not legible off the lot on which they are situated, such as drive-up menu boards.
  • Corporate or commercial flags not exceeding 5 feet above roofline and 15 square feet in area, not advertising specific products or services, spaced 10 feet apart, up to 8 flags per lot/structure.
  • Small illuminated or non-illuminated incidental signs, such as directional, not exceeding 4 square feet and 4 feet high, and not snipe signs.
  • Small temporary signs (max 3 square feet) placed adjacent to menu boards, building entrances, or landscape beds within 15 feet of the building; not in parking lot islands or yards adjacent to street right-of-way.
  • Light pole bracket signs (on commercial development interior parking lot light poles) not exceeding 10 square feet and minimum 8 feet above grade.
  • Political signs not exceeding 16 square feet, not placed sooner than 30 days before primary election or remaining later than 7 days after general election, not in right-of-way, and only on private property with owner's permission.
  • Public information signs such as gateway entry signs to the City, or signs identifying public parks or facilities.
  • Real estate signs as detailed in residential sign regulations.
  • Signs on single-family residential lots for school pride or recognition of local students.
  • Shrink-wrapped signs on personal vehicles.
  • Garage sale signs on premises (max 4 sq ft), additional directional/sale sign at subdivision entrances, one on each side of community board, not in public right-of-way, not posted more than 3 consecutive days, removed within 24 hours after sale.
  • Temporary signs at sports fields or on sports field fences do not require permits or compliance with sign code, but require user agreement approval.
  • Gas price signs displaying only the price of gasoline, not located within public right-of-way and not counting against temporary sign allowances.

Sign Plan & Submission Notes for Skiatook

  • A Unified Sign Plan (USP) is required for developments seeking comprehensive sign criteria differing from code for property being developed as a unit (not for single lot developments).
  • USPs must include location, size, height, construction material, color, type of illumination, and orientation of all proposed signs.
  • USPs are reviewed by the Planning Commission and must conform to all conditions imposed prior to a sign permit being issued.
  • USPs must cover all signage for the subject site, regardless of whether they exceed code or not.
  • USPs cannot propose sign square footage above 3 sq ft per 1 linear foot of street frontage.
  • USPs cannot include prohibited signs.
  • Unified Sign Plan requires Planning Commission approval and an application fee of $400.
  • Variances from the Sign Code require approval by the Board of Adjustment and must demonstrate a hardship.
  • Any mural sign painted on a building must be approved by the City Council.
  • Any person served notice of violation has a right to appeal to the Planning Commission; the Commission can affirm, amend, or reverse the notice/action.
